The Thunder have moved quickly to replace QB Paul Robinson, who broke his wrist against the London Blitz. Will Greystone, who led the team to post-season action in 2005, returns to the club after a two year absence due to family & work commitments.
Also joining the club is centre Steven Clements, who has moved over from the Colchester Gladiators. Steve was a member of the all-powerful London Olympians squad for a number of years, collecting a number of National Championships whilst anchoring their offensive line.
Club Chairman Tony Miller said, “Steve made a guest appearance for us in an exhibition game two weeks ago and liked what we are trying to put together and decided to join us for another spell of top flight football. He is a proven leader and will be a great asset to the team. With him and Ian McLean returning as well, it’s two top class additions to our squad. Will is a very intelligent player, has been practising with us for a few weeks now, and has quickly got his old touch back. He is an excellent athlete who can also play wide receiver”.
